Why This Job Matters:
The Early Careers & Apprenticeship Specialist supports the Product Owner in the definition, deployment and ongoing management of Early Careers & Apprenticeship products and programs across the organization as well as owning and driving key businesses-as-usual activities in that space.
They will drives or oversee all activities related to the administration and running of Apprenticeships, including application of levy in an efficient, effective and compliance manner. Supports the Senior Specialist in managing the relationship with relevant government bodies to ensure we apply the levy in a compliant and efficient manner.

Skills and Experience You’ll Need:
- Inclusively identifies, develops, and retains talented employees to support the effectiveness of the organisation as a whole. Facilitating activities and opportunities that get the best out of talented employees
- Plans, prepares and facilitates a talent review program in which leaders review employees' strengths, development areas, and potential career trajectories
- Evaluates a talent pool, identifying key candidates and tracking competitors' new hires
- Identifies, attracts, selects and retains talented individuals
- Monitors and improves mobility processes within an organisation, while empowering employees' development and improving satisfaction
- Helps employees gain and develop leadership competencies and prepares them for management and leadership roles within an organisation
- Can clearly articulate the current business performance and leverage the people levers to enhance performance or productivity
- Is able to develop a clear business case that outlines the context, insight, the proposal and a method to evaluate the impact of the intervention
- Collects and interprets data in order to uncover patterns and trends
- Manages projects by dividing tasks into short phases of work (known as sprints) and frequently reassess and adapt plans
- Identifies, evaluates and manages risks by developing and implementing strategies, frameworks, policies, procedures and practices
